speaker’s decision is illegal:

Bengaluru: Former State Advocate General (AG) B.V. Acharya has said that Karnataka Assembly Speaker Ramesh Kumar’s order disqualifying 17 rebel MLAs from the Congress and JD(S), as illegal.

Speaking to press persons here yesterday, Acharya said that the Supreme Court in its July 17 order had asked the Speaker to only look into the resignations submitted by the MLAs and not on their disqualification. But the Speaker seems to have ignored the SC directive while disqualifying the rebel Legislators, he said.
